After playing football in college at a number of offensive line positions, he settled at left offensive guard for the Oakland Raiders in the American Football League and the National Football League for 15 years. During that time, he played in three Super Bowls; in the 1967, 1976, and 1980 seasons, making him the first player to reach the game in three different decades (Jerry Rice and Bill Romanowski would later accomplish the feat in 2002, while Tom Brady later accomplished the fe… WebAug 22, 2008 · Gene Upshaw, N.F.L. WebMarvin Allen "Marv" Upshaw is a former American football defensive lineman in the National Football League. He played nine seasons for the Cleveland Browns , the Kansas City Chiefs and the St. Louis Cardinals .
